>I have already done that. I add a combobox to the column, and when focus is on that column, I get the list of descriptions that I want and the combo box fills in the proper company ID into the company field in table1. The problem is that when focus leaves that column, the field that is displayed is the company ID field. Anyone have any suggestions?
First, u need to have Sparse property of column 1 set to .F.
Second, u may reverse the order in wich u show the columns in the combo, having first de description and then the ID, and set the BoundColumn property of the combo set to 2.
